Topics: Engaging with Employers License and Distribution: ACE-WIL Copyright Tags: funding, SWPP Get Funding WebThe Mitacs Accelerate program provides support for research partnerships including funding for internships. Organizations partner with academic researchers to develop a project proposal, and must provide a financial contribution of at least $7,500, which is matched by Mitacs. Projects can include multiple interns and span multiple terms.

WebFunding is provided for net new positions that are over and above what the employer usually hires or for new positions. Placements can range from 4 to 16 weeks, full or part time, with a minimum of 10 hours per week. Employers can apply for back-to-back placements for the same student.

WebFunding will cover up to 50% of student wages. Students hired from under-represented groups, including first-year students, women in STEM, indigenous students, persons with disabilities and newcomers, may be eligible to have up to 70% of their wages subsidized.
